Innate immunity includes all of the following EXCEPT inflammation. production of antibody. phagocytosis. activation of complement. production of interferon.

Step 1: Innate immunity is the immunity that is present at birth and includes mechanisms such as inflammation, phagocytosis, activation of complement, and production of interferon. Show more…
